BRINGING PROFESSIONALISM TO BRAND PANKHARI

Colorful handmade Phulkari Dupattas and intricately crafted Juttis from Patiala are much sought after throughout the country. Local talents in this Punjab district are skilled and creative, with the majority of them being women from remote rural areas. To assist them, the district administration has established an umbrella brand called Pankhari, which serves as a market for all products created by women SHGs. 

The initiative, which has been taken under the direction of DC Patiala, Sakshi Sawhney, is helping the women from the SHGs to become more professional, and, thereby, empowered.

SHG Women In Kanpur Dehat Earning Around Rs 80K Each 

2017 batch IAS officer Saumya Pandey’s journey as an achiever started young. Less than a decade into her career, she has scripted success stories across districts of Uttar Pradesh. From inspiring and helping women to come out of conservative homes to making a five-digit income by joining SHGs, this officer has transformed cities of garbage into the ‘No. 2 cleanest one’, besides improving the education of a janpad by bringing in smart classes to humble government schools.

Under the aegis of the Uttar Pradesh Government’s Mission Shakti for empowering women economically, she established Prerna canteens run by Self-Help groups of women that cater to all government offices, blocks, tehsils, thanas, RTO offices, and hospitals.

The women under the Prerna ‘janpad’ scheme run solar lighting, canteens, and also tailor school uniforms, making a lump-sum amount that allows them to be decision-makers.

A DM Office With A Difference: Special Counters for SHGs, Open Work Spaces For Staff

These days, visitors to the Collector’s office in the Khowai district of Tripura are greeted with a strange sight. The government office has a very different look, with tastefully designed shelves showcasing colorful local wares. However, the wares are not ordinary products, as they have been handmade by SHGs.

To encourage the SHGs of the district, the DM of Khowai, Ms. Chandni Chandran, a 2017-batch IAS officer, started this unique initiative in her own office, and has now asked all other government offices, from headquarters to block level, to follow suit.

Punyashree Stores Of Pune Empowering Women SHGs

In the post-pandemic economy, Pune Zila Parishad has come up with a magic wand that uses local products to generate prosperity and jobs in the district. 

To promote and provide retail space for products manufactured by Self-Help Groups (SHGs) in the Maharashtra district, the Pune District Rural Development Authority has established Punyashree Stores. Forty-one such stores have been set up across the district since January with the help of capital subsidy schemes and bank loans. 

The concept behind it is a D-mart store, small but a proper market to purchase products. Pune Zila Parishad CEO, Ayush Prasad, a 2015 IAS batch officer, informed Indian Masterminds that these stores came up, “in a bid to double household incomes by increasing the participation of women in the workforce and also to help overcome the challenge of finding retail space for products manufactured by self-help groups”.
